Jhalan Jackson hit a two-run homer during a three-run fourth inning Saturday as the Trenton Thunder beat the visiting Portland Sea Dogs, 3-1.

Luke Tendler put Portland ahead 1-0 with an RBI single in the second inning before Trenton’s three-run rally.

Cole Sturgeon extended his on-base streak to 14 games to begin the season for Portland with a walk in the fifth.

ARENA FOOTBALL

MAMMOTHS WIN: The Maine Mammoths secured the first victory in franchise history, defeating the Lehigh Valley Steelhawks 45-24 at Bethlehem, Pennsylvania.

The Mammoths (1-2) used a 20-0 run in the fourth quarter to beat the Steelhawks (0-2).

AUTO RACING

NASCAR: Kyle Busch pulled away on a restart in a two-lap overtime sprint to the finish at Richmond, Virginia, and won his third consecutive race in the Cup Series.

Busch, who started 32nd but quickly worked his way into contention, outran Chase Elliott and teammate Denny Hamlin for his fifth career victory at Richmond. The victory is his 46th overall.

SOCCER

FA CUP: Ander Herrera scored the winning goal as Manchester United secured a place in the final by beating Tottenham 2-1 at London.

Chelsea and Southampton will meet Sunday in the other semifinal.

SPANISH CUP: Barcelona became the first team in 85 years to win four straight Copa del Rey titles, blowing away Sevilla 5-0 at Madrid.

MLS: Cristian Penilla scored the tying goal in the first minute of first-half stoppage time and the visiting New England Revolution held on for a 2-2 tie with the Columbus Crew.

GOLF

PGA: Zach Johnson birdied the par-5 18th at the Valero Texas Open for a share of the third-round lead with Andrew Landry, a stroke ahead of record-setting Trey Mullinax.

Johnson shot a 4-under 68, holing a 10-footer on 18 to match Landry at 13-under 203. Landry birdied the 16th and 17th in a 67. Mullinax had a course-record 62.

LPGA: Moriya Jutanugarn overcame a poor start and birdied the 18th for a hard-earned 1-under 70 to tie Jin Young Ko at 9 under going into the final round of the HUGEL-JTBC LA Open at Los Angeles.

CHAMPIONS TOUR: The defending champion team of Vijay Singh and Carlos Franco took the third-round lead in the Bass Pro Shops Legends of Golf at Ridgedale, Missouri.

EUROPEAN TOUR: A birdie on the last hole gave Alvaro Quiros a one-shot lead going into the final round of the Trophee Hassan II at Rabat, Morocco.

TENNIS

MONTE CARLO MASTERS: Rafael Nadal beat Grigor Dimitrov 6-4, 6-1 in the semifinals at Monaco.

The top-ranked Nadal will face Kei Nishikori, who beat No. 4-ranked Alexander Zverev, 3-6, 6-3, 6-4.

FED CUP: Kristina Mladenovic rallied to beat CoCo Vandeweghe 1-6, 6-3, 6-2 and draw France level with defending champion United States in their semifinal at Aix-En-Provence, France.

PREP SCHOOLS

SOFTBALL: McKayla Leary was 3 for 3 with a double, a walk and two runs to lead the Winsor School (2-3) to a 18-11 win over Berwick Academy (0-3) at South Berwick.

Charlotte Wensley had two hits, walked and scored three runs, and Jaiden Williams finished with two hits, a walk, and two runs for Berwick.
